Katy’s story

I am a 14 year old girl living in Maryland. I first noticed something was wrong in August 2011, the week before my PC became really bad and noticeable I was at summer camp.

Toward the end of the week I had noticed a pain in my lower back, thinking it was just the cot I was sleeping on was the problem I just left it. Then the next week I could barely walk and in immense pain. After going to the doctors I was put onto some anti-biotics, after about two weeks the problem went away.

Then around the end of November it came back, again I was on anti-biotics, the problem faded, but didn’t go away all the way. By March my doctor recommended I have surgery, it took a while to find a surgeon that would work on children. Once we did he wanted to do surgery immediately, I ended up wait for the school year to end and had surgery in June, it was worse than the surgeon had thought and I had to have more invasive surgery in August. The problem was gone for about three weeks.

Again I had surgery near the end of November. It was back by Christmas, so again I had surgery for the fourth time in early January. It was back by mid- February, by this time I had missed of a month of school total, in March I had a particularly bad flare up and missed more than two weeks of school. In early April I had another surgery for a total of five in less then ten months. Because of missing so much school I was failing every one of my classes, we don’t even know if I’m going to pass my grade.

But I thought I should share, and maybe help other people.
